Multilevel inverters have great applications
nowadays as one of preferred solutions for medium and high
power applications. As one of the most popular hybrid multilevel
inverter topologies, the five-level active-neutral-point-clamped
inverter combines the features of the conventional flying-capacitor type and Neutral-Point-Clamped (NPC) type inverter and was commercially used for industrial applications. In order to further decrease the number of active switches, this paper proposes a five-level five-switch NPC topology, which employs only five active switches and four discrete diodes. The modulation strategy for five-level five-switch NPC inverter is discussed. A 4KVA single phase prototype is simulated using the PSPICE software to verify the validity and flexibility of the proposed topology and control method.
